The R&D team is a rapidly growing division that combines engineers, scientists, and tax professionals, in order to service clients in maximizing Scientific Research and Experimental Development (SR&ED) tax claims. As a team, they are responsible for:
Examining client operations and processes to determine which qualify for income tax incentives, developing the appropriate methodology to claim those activities and the methods to maximize those incentives.
Preparing all necessary technical documentation to file an R&D claim on behalf of the client.
Working with the client to help them develop their systems and know-how to assist in making future claims.
Involvement in all discussions that may arise with the Canadian Revenue Agency and/or provincial authorities.
Assessing R&D expenditures, time and activities involved within all of the projects.
